Curtiss-Wright Corporation has acquired Cimarron Energy Inc., through the acquisition of its parent company Cimarron Energy Holding Company LLC, for approximately USD$135.1 million.
“With the acquisition of Cimarron, Curtiss-Wright is diversifying from our current downstream refining segment into the emerging, high growth U.S. shale oil and gas market in the upstream and midstream segments of the industry,” said Chairman and CEO of Curtiss-Wright Corporation, Martin R. Benante. “Its products and services expand our mission-critical, production-focused flow control offerings for the oil and gas industry, and also offer new, high growth production lines focused on the environmental aspects of hydraulic fracturing.”
Cimarron is a leading manufacturer of highly customized and engineered energy production, processing and environmental solutions for the U.S. oil and gas industry. The business will become part of Curtiss-Wright’s Flow Control segment.
“In addition, Cimarron provides significant opportunities for Curtiss-Wright to build new market share in the U.S. and Canada, as well as international markets,” said Benante. “The U.S. has vast reserves of shale oil and natural gas that will help drive the country towards energy independence. We are excited about further diversifying our product portfolio into the robust upstream and midstream markets.”
